Home » TOURISM NEWS » Two Norfolk Beaches Named Among Best in the UK: Brancaster and Sea Palling Stand Out Monday, July 7, 2025There are currently two stunning Norfolk beaches included in the list of the 2025 best UK beaches as per the highly acclaimed list by The Sunday Times. Brancaster and Sea Palling were recognized in the Times and Sunday Times annual best beach guide that determines the ultimate 50 best UK beaches. Norfolk’s Brancaster and Sea Palling beaches were mentioned as significant locations for beach enthusiasts next year due to their natural beauty, good amenities, and warm atmosphere.The Sunday Times’ ranking is based on rigorous criteria that includes factors such as water quality, cleanliness, accessibility, car-parking facilities, lifeguard presence, and the quality of restroom hygiene. The comprehensive judging process ensures that only the finest beaches across the country are recognized, and Norfolk’s representation in this list is a testament to the county’s growing reputation as a top seaside destination.Brancaster: A Beach of Tranquility and Natural BeautyAmong the two Norfolk beaches to be featured, Brancaster stands out as a tranquil retreat offering golden sands and picturesque views. Often praised for its calming atmosphere, Brancaster Beach has earned a reputation for its peaceful vibe, making it a perfect spot for those seeking a serene escape. The Sunday Times describes the beach as having a “yoga-like effect” on the mind, thanks to its quiet beauty and vast, unspoiled landscape.Brancaster’s wide, sandy shores make it an ideal destination for families, couples, and nature lovers. The beach is also renowned for being part of the North Norfolk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ty (AONB), which ensures that its surroundings remain pristine and well-preserved. The area is also home to rich wildlife, including birdlife and marine species, making it a popular spot for nature enthusiasts and photographers.As part of the judging process, the publication noted that Brancaster excels in many important aspects, including cleanliness, ease of access, and its dog-friendly nature. The beach offers ample space for dogs to run free, making it an attractive option for pet owners. With plenty of parking, easy access to local amenities, and safe swimming areas, Brancaster is a must-visit destination for those exploring the Norfolk coastline.Sea Palling: A Hidden Gem with Sheltered BaysThe second Norfolk beach to receive recognition is Sea Palling, a hidden gem that is a favorite among locals and visitors alike. The Sunday Times praised the beach for its “spotlessly clean” golden sand and its nine sheltered bays that make it ideal for families. The beach is sheltered by a series of sand dunes and nature reserves, creating a safe and inviting environment for beachgoers of all ages.Sea Palling has long been admired for its calm waters and scenic beauty, and it continues to attract visitors looking for a peaceful coastal experience. The beach is particularly well-suited for children, as the shallow waters make it safe for swimming and paddling. Additionally, the area’s lifeguard presence ensures that safety remains a top priority.With its clean facilities, including well-maintained restrooms and showers, Sea Palling ranks highly for hygiene and comfort, essential factors that contribute to its popularity. The beach is also highly accessible, with nearby parking options, making it easy for families and other visitors to enjoy a full day by the sea.Skegness: Best Beach in the East of EnglandWhile Brancaster and Sea Palling have earned recognition as two of the best beaches in the UK, Skegness in Lincolnshire was named the top beach in the East of England. Known for its traditional charm, Skegness has long been a popular destination for families looking for a quintessential British seaside experience. Despite some challenges faced by seaside resorts in recent years, Skegness remains an upbeat, vibrant destination that continues to attract visitors year after year.The Sunday Times highlighted Skegness’ “unapologetically cheap and cheerful” atmosphere, which is combined with a magnificent beach and all the traditional seaside ingredients. From amusement arcades to fish and chips by the sea, Skegness offers visitors the full package of a British seaside getaway.
